LoginSignup
0
0

Dockerfileとdocker-composeを使用してコンテナ作成

Last updated at Posted at 2024-05-15

Dockerfileとdocker-composeを使用してコンテナ作成

Dockerファイルはユーザがイメージを組み立てるために呼び出せるコマンドを含めたドキュメントになります。

ドライブの適当な場所に、フォルダを作成し、Dockerfileと、docker-compose.ymlファイルを作成します。

フォルダ構成は以下のようになります。

 .
 |---- docker-compose.yml
 |---- Dockerfile

まずは、Dockerfileには 以下のようにイメージを記載します。

FROM hello-world

docker-compose.ymlファイルには以下のように記載をします。

services:
  my-aws-app:
    build:
      context: .

ファイルを保存し、Dockerfileとdocker-compose.ymlの上のフォルダの場所でコマンドを

docker-compose up

docker-compose up

と入力し起動します。

コンテナ名には{フォルダ名}-myaws-app-{数字}という形になりますので、こちらを駆使すれば複数コンテナ起動も可能です。

000.png

0
0
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0